Marie Anne ARSENAULT was born abt. 1747 in Acadia, Canada. Marie Anne ARSENAULT was the child of Pierre ARSENAULT (ARCENAULT) (ARSENEAU) and Françoise POIRIER and the grandchild of: (paternal) Charles ARSENAULT (ARCENAULT) (ARSENEAU) and Françoise MIRANDE LAMIRANDE-TAVARE (maternal) Louis POIRIER and Cecile MIGNAULT (MIGNEAULT)
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Marie Anne married Joseph LANDRY 25 January 1773 in Bécancour, Nicolet, Province of Québec, Canada . The couple had (at least) 2 children. Joseph LANDRY was born abt. 1742 in Grand Pré, Nova Scotia, Canada (Saint-Charles-des-Mines, Acadia). Joseph died 5 September 1831 in Saint-Grégoire, Nicolet, Québec, Canada (Saint-Grégoire-le-Grand) (Bécancour)*. Joseph was the child of Alexis LANDRY and Marguerite AUCOIN.
Marie Anne ARSENAULT died 28 April 1822 in Saint-Grégoire, Nicolet, Lower Canada .

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
